Vallisassoli’s 33/33/33 white wine

33/33/33 is a blend of three native varietals of the Campania region: Fiano, Greco and Coda di Volpe, which are cultivated to be biodynamic by Paolo Clemente at his Vallisassoli estate.
Paolo Clemente is the owner-operator of the small Vallisassoli estate in San Martino Valle Caudina in the province of Avellino. Here he produces just one wine made from Greco, Fiano and Coda di Volpe grapes.
His vineyard is about a hectare in size with 30-year-old vines that are trained using the traditional pergola Avellinese method. On the advice of enologist Maurizio De Simone, the varieties are vinified separately and then blended later.
Biodynamic methods are observed in both the vineyard and the winery and production today is only 2,000 bottles.
